Brand
Vacancy title
Head of HR India
Ref
19499
Function
HR & Admin
City
Chennai
Salary
Competitive
Closing date
30/06/2021
Description

 

Triumph is one of the world’s largest intimate apparel companies. It enjoys a presence in over 120 countries with the core brands Triumph® and sloggi®. Globally, the company serves 40,000 wholesale customers and sells its products in 3,600 controlled points of sale as well as via several own online shops. The Triumph Group is a member of the Business Social Compliance Initiative (BSCI).

 

Learn more about Triumph on:

www.triumph.com

www.linkedin.com/company/triumph-international/

 

 

Our Human Resources Department in India is looking immediately for a highly motivated

 

                                                                                           Head of HR India (f/m) 

                                                                                                (Working 100 %)

 

 

Purpose of the Job:

Provide support to managers in the area of responsibility to achieve Development, Performance Management, and Employee Engagement, Employee Relations objectives by supporting the definition & implementation of the necessary people actions and interventions.

Steer business results by supporting the definition & implementation of the necessary people actions & interventions to successfully execute the business strategy.

Drive the execution of the end-to-end HR lifecycle activities in the respective business area to support the company’s Mission, Vision, and Strategy.

Provide expert advice on all matters relating to the development of the organization and execution capability of teams and individuals.

 

Roles & Responsibilities:

  • First point of contact for employees and managers to provide support to better understand and utilize HR tools, processes and policies; maximizing organizational effectiveness, improve performance, and ensuring compliance
  • Responsible for Production and Sales
  • Manage the operational aspects of local payroll, administrative processes, HRIT and manage the performance (service, productivity, and quality) of a team of HR Operations Specialists delivering day-to-day services to all employees and managers
  • Collaborate with internal legal / compliance/tax teams or external third parties for advice and decisions on how to interpret local legislation/ regulations/ policies
  • Manage the payroll, time attendance, leave, and employee benefits according to local legal requirements – monitor compliance, process illness, and accident data so that appropriate adjustments can be made and any relevant authorities are notified
  • Support the Global HR Business Partner in implementing a cohesive, coherent people plan for the respective business area where the subsequent solutions and actions are aligned with the business strategy
  • Work closely with the business in the annual budgeting and forecasting process of headcounts and personnel cost
  • Support the GHR BP in ensuring best-in-class processes are applied in the business as Employee Relations, Workforce Planning, Recruitment, Staffing Review, Learning & Development, Career & Talent Management, Performance Management, Employee Engagement, Compensation & Benefits, Organizational Development, Change Management
  • Responsible for the coordination of recruitment with our external recruitment partners and drive onboarding process to ensure smooth and quick integration to the company for all levels below senior department heads
  • Ensure Triumph’s Values and Principles, as well as the Code of Conduct, are adhered and complied to at all times
  • Support the Global HR BP with the deployment of new global policies by engaging stakeholders, communicating, and executing implementation actions within the area of responsibility
  • Support the Global HR BP with people interventions when required 

 

Your ideal profile:

  • Minimum 10 years of broad generalist HR experience gained across a variety of businesses, markets, cultures. Preferably in the manufacturing area, ideally the candidate would also have experience in garment manufacturing
  • Minimum 3 years of international HR experience (international HR projects and processes) in a similar role
  • Proven experience in operational/ payroll matters
  • Experience in using HR software solutions
  • Data savvy, good with numbers
  • Bachelor’s level in Human Resources or Business Administration
  • Professional HR qualification would be an advantage
  • Technical Skills: Solid experience in business partner, employee relations, employment law, Project Management, Conflict Management, Influencing
  • Language Skills:  Fluent in English and local language
  • IT proficiency: Proficient in the use of MS Office
  • Ability to anticipate, identify, diagnose and resolve employee issues affecting business performance
  • Ability to work independently with tight timelines and multiple priorities in a fast-paced environment
  • Ability to establish relationships with all levels of an organization 

 

We offer an opportunity in a fast-paced organization which gives those looking for a challenge the possibility to grow with the company and shape the future.

We are a family-owned company with strong values, operating at a global level with key markets in Germany, Japan, and China - where our iconic brands, Sloggi and Triumph, continue to delight our consumers.

Triumph Group is committed to employing a diverse workforce. Qualified applicants will receive consideration without regard to race, color, religion, sex, national origin, age, sexual orientation, gender identity, gender expression, veteran status, or disability. 

If you are seeking a great opportunity to develop your career, please send us your application letter and CV in English, diplomas, and expected salary range by clicking on Apply.